Output 758fbfa81e8203163e7ddbdfc42843ab7ca349bf8fd11b3c3f0e96e070a0ad9c:30

value
527676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0607ea2a019da281ed9e437e37bd801a2878a42d OP_EQUAL
address
32EuTco7nMfTNwhAyv8BsaLgcvryAnwSyz
transaction
758fbfa81e8203163e7ddbdfc42843ab7ca349bf8fd11b3c3f0e96e070a0ad9c
spent
true